Frontier was not able to break out of their rough patch on Monday as the team picked up their fourth straight loss. They fell 3-1 to the Belpre Golden Eagles.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Golden Eagles this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 3-2 back in August.
While Frontier had to settle for second, they sure made a game of it, scoring at least 20 points in every set they played. The match finished with set scores of 25-21, 14-25, 25-22, 25-20.
Frontier's defeat came despite a true team effort with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Kenzie Livingston, who had 19 digs and two aces.
Frontier's loss dropped their record down to 7-11. As for Belpre, with the win, they broke their 14-match losing streak and moved their record to 2-15.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Frontier will take on Shadyside at 6:00 p.m. on Wednesday. As for Belpre,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Eastern at 7:15 p.m. on Thursday.
